Nate...if Andrew isn't around..
2 7mm under ashtray
Lift console lid and remove false bottom. 2 10 mm under there
Remove shifter head by pulling the small clip out of the front.
Set ebrake
Shift car to D or OD
lift center console.. remove last 4 10mm..
Remove little thingy that holds the front of the console flaps together.

IT"* OUT
